Services available:
The Randall Lakes Area Clinic has the capabilities to
care for most primary care health needs (illnesses,
minor injuries, etc.). In addition, the following are
some services available:
* Physicals
(work, sports, DOT, pre-operative, etc.)
* Lab work and blood draws
* Immunizations
* Injections (e.g. Vitamin B-12, flu shots, Depo-Provera)
* Child and teen checkups
* Blood pressure screening
* SAGE breast & cervical cancer screening
* Minor procedures (i.e.: wart, mole, or skin lesion
removal)

Location:
The
Randall Lakes Area Clinic is located just east of the
intersection of US Highway 10 and MN State Highway 115
at 250 White Oak Drive in Randall. The clinic phone
number is 320-749-2877.

Staff:
Michelle
Dahlberg, PA-C, ATC
Michelle is a board-certified physician assistant and
certified athletic trainer. She is the primary care
provider at the Randall Lakes Area Clinic and is on
the medical staff of Family Medical Center, a multi-specialty
clinic based in Little Falls with satellite clinics
in Pierz and Randall. Michelle earned her Bachelor of
Science degree in athletic training and psychology from
South Dakota State University in Brookings and holds
a Master of Arts in Kinesiology from the University
of Minnesota.
She
completed her physician assistant training through Augsburg
College in Minneapolis and was recently re-certified
as a physician assistant, which involves passing a comprehensive
written exam.
Terry
Witt, LPN, is a licensed practical nurse and
serves as the primary nurse at the Randall Lakes Area
Clinic. Terry has more than 30 years of experience in
health care having served as the nurse for general and
orthopedic surgeons, a foot surgeon (podiatrist) and
in the specialty outreach clinics at St. Gabriel's Hospital.
In addition to her clinical expertise and experience
(triaging phone calls, assisting health care providers
with treatment and follow-up), she's also adept at completing
Worker's Compensation and other insurance authorizations
and assisting patients with their insurance verification
and authorization needs. Terry is also responsible for
processing lab work at the clinic.
Louise
Block is a certified nursing assistant, a certified
home health aide and has completed a variety of courses
related to medical insurance authorization and verification.
She has previously served as a human services technician
for the State of Minnesota and worked with Mille Lacs
Health System in Onamia. Louise is the receptionist
for the Randall Lakes Area Clinic with responsibilities
for scheduling appointments and patient registration.
James
Gehant, MD, is a family practice physician.
Dr. Gehant is board-certified by the American Board
of Family Practice and is responsible for overseeing
the medical care provided at the Randall Lakes Area
Clinic.
